For instance, one may end up evaluating customer feedback for the ...Root cause analysis (RCA) is a process for identifying the root causes of problems and a systematic approach to responding to them. Root cause analysis is based on the idea that effective management should find a way to prevent problems before they occur and affect the work of an entire organization. A problem statement is a concise description of the problem or issues a project seeks to address. The problem statement identifies the current state, the desired future state and any gaps between the two. A problem statement is an important communication tool that can help ensure everyone working on a project knows what the problem they need to ... ….

While descriptive statistics summarize the characteristics of a data set, inferential statistics help you come to conclusions and make predictions based on your data. Fishbone Diagram A fishbone diagram is a way to visualize a problem with multiple root causes and to categorize root causes.
